  • Intel 320 Series SSD on Gigabyte X58A-UD3R Benchmarks

    Since i havent found any benchmarks of Intel 320 SSD 80GB over the internet i would like to share some screenshots how the disks perform in Raid 0 on Gigabyte X58A-UD3R (ICH10R)

    The Stripe Size is 16k as recommended from Intel when using 2x SSD on Raid 0
    Im using the latest RST Drivers and latest Option ROM From Intel (ty to LSD for modified Bios)
    The system was in normal state with C1E Enabled (No overclocking at all)

    Imageshack - intel320r0.jpg

    And thats the performance of the latest version of Vertex 2 in Raid 0 on Same System:




    P.S Forgot to mention that OCZ are the Vertex 2 50GB With Part Number OCZSSD2-2VTX50G

    Both Benchmarks were executed After Secure Erase the drives and right after Restore Of OS on them.
    Overall Feeling at OS as Boot times and app loading etc seems the same for both disks with Intel Being alot lot faster while Restoring Operating System on them
    Where OCZ Fails is when you trying to move files across other disks on Computer for example i also have a Raid 0 Array on same system with 4x Velociraptors.
    With Intel im able to move Large ISOS there with 390mb /s while with OCZ it takes longer with average rate of 180mb/s
    When im moving a game folder from Velociraptor Array to SSD Array with Intel it does with average 230mb/s and with OCZ 70mb/s
